Replacing windows is a custom project, so the final total depends on a few specific variables. The size and style of the frames you choose—like double-hung versus casement—will change the materials cost. We also look at the glass packages, such as double or triple-pane options, and any energy-efficient coatings that help with insulation. If your window frame is in great shape but the glass is cracked, foggy, or broken, you might only need a glass replacement. This service involves removing the failed insulated glass unit and installing a new one to restore clarity and efficiency. Vinyl windows are often a top choice for value, offering good insulation and durability for the Indiana climate. Double-pane windows with low-E coatings are essential for managing heating and cooling costs. The pros can help you weigh your options based on your budget.

Leading competitors to Andersen include Pella, Marvin, and Jeld-Wen, each offering a variety of window styles and materials. The best option for you will depend on your specific needs for performance, aesthetics, and budget. The pros can discuss these brands with you.
